| Obverse description | A detailed architectural rendering of the Haji Bektash Veli Complex (Hacıbektaş Dergâhı) occupies the central field, depicted in three-quarter perspective showing the stone-built tekke with its characteristic conical-roofed türbe and pitched roof sections with arched portal entrances. The Turkish crescent and star emblem appears in the upper field above the complex. The legend TÜRKİYE CUMHURİYETİ arcs along the upper border, while the denomination 20 Türk Lirası and the bilingual legend REPUBLIC OF TURKEY are inscribed in the lower field, flanked by decorative dots; the date 2021 and the Darphane mint mark appear centrally above the denomination. |

| Reverse description | A robust bust portrait of the Sufi mystic and philosopher Haci Bektaş Veli faces slightly left, rendered in high relief against a deeply mirrored proof field. He is depicted wearing a distinctive tall tapered dervish tac (crown), a traditional Bektashi headpiece, with a full beard and robes rendered in fine frosted detail. The legend HACI BEKTAŞ VELİ arcs along the left border and ÖLÜMÜNÜN 750. YILI along the right border, commemorating the 750th anniversary of his death. The birth and death years 1209–1271 are inscribed in the lower exergue. |
